Distinctive Signals of spontaneous R-parity breaking at LEP-II

Abstract
We consider the signals of pair-produced charginos in an $e^{+}e^{-}$ collider, in a scenario where R-parity is spontaneously broken. The possibility of lepton-chargino mixing, together with the presence of a Majoron, opens up the two-body decay channel of a chargino into a tau and a Majoron. We have studied the regions where this is the dominant decay of a chargino, and have shown that over a large region of the parameter space the ensuing signals, namely tau-pairs with missing-$p_T$, may rise well above standard model backgrounds at LEP-II. Such signals can also enable one to distinguish between spontaneous and explicit R-parity breaking.
